页面加载速度优化,提升用户体验与网站效率的关键
随着互联网技术的飞速发展,人们对网页的加载速度要求越来越高,页面加载速度不仅影响用户体验,还直接关系到网站的流量和转化率,对页面加载速度进行优化显得尤为重要,本文将介绍页面加载速度优化的关键方法和策略,以提高用户体验和网站效率。
页面加载速度优化的重要性
1、提升用户体验:快速加载的页面能够提供更好的用户体验,降低用户等待时间,提高用户满意度。
2、提高搜索引擎排名:页面加载速度是影响搜索引擎排名的重要因素之一,优化加载速度有助于提高网站在搜索引擎中的排名。
3、增加转化率:快速的页面加载速度能够减少用户流失,提高网站的转化率,从而增加收益。
页面加载速度优化的关键策略
1、减少HTTP请求
HTTP请求是网页加载的主要瓶颈之一,减少HTTP请求数量可以显著提高页面加载速度,可以通过以下方法实现:
(1)合并文件:将多个CSS或JavaScript文件合并为单个文件,减少请求数量。
(2)使用CDN:利用内容分发网络(CDN)缓存静态资源,减少请求延迟。
(3)懒加载:对于非首屏加载的内容,采用懒加载技术,延迟加载非关键资源。
2、优化图片和媒体资源
图片和媒体资源是网页中占用带宽最大的部分,优化这些资源可以有效提高页面加载速度,可以采取以下措施:
(1)压缩图片:使用图像压缩工具对图片进行压缩,减小文件大小。
(2)使用适当的格式:选择适合网页显示的图片格式,如WebP、AVIF等。
(3)优化视频资源:采用视频懒加载技术,延迟加载视频资源,提高页面加载速度。
3、缓存技术
利用缓存技术可以避免重复传输相同的数据,提高页面加载速度,可以采取以下措施:
(1)浏览器缓存:设置合适的缓存规则,让浏览器缓存静态资源,减少重复请求。

(2)服务端缓存:在服务器端设置缓存,减少数据库查询等耗时操作。
(3)使用CDN缓存:通过CDN分发内容,提高用户访问速度,减轻服务器压力。
4、优化代码
优化前端代码可以提高页面的渲染速度,从而提高页面加载速度,可以采取以下措施:
(1)压缩代码:去除无用代码、精简JavaScript和CSS代码,减小文件大小。
(2)代码拆分:将代码拆分为多个小文件,按需加载,提高页面渲染速度。
(3)使用异步加载:使用异步加载技术,让页面在加载过程中不阻塞主线程,提高页面响应速度。
5、选择高效的主机或服务器
主机或服务器的性能直接影响网页的加载速度,选择高效的主机或服务器可以提高页面加载速度,可以采取以下措施:
(1)选择高性能主机:选择配置高性能的主机,提高服务器的处理能力。
(2)使用负载均衡:通过负载均衡技术,分散服务器压力,提高服务器响应速度。
(3) 选择靠近用户的服务器:将服务器部署在靠近用户的地方,减少网络延迟,提高用户访问速度。
页面加载速度优化是提高用户体验和网站效率的关键,通过减少HTTP请求、优化图片和媒体资源、利用缓存技术、优化代码以及选择高效的主机或服务器等措施,可以有效提高页面加载速度,在实际应用中,应根据网站的特点和需求,综合考虑各种优化策略,以实现最佳的优化效果。





